How much does mold removal cost in Dubai?« Back to Previous Page

After the rain last month, I noticed some mold growing on the walls of my apartment, particularly in the bedroom. It’s a bit concerning because there are also musty odors that won’t go away. Should I hire professionals to assess and remove it or is DIY sufficient? What are the typical costs for such services in Dubai?

In the UAE, particularly in Dubai, mold removal costs can vary significantly based on several factors including the extent of contamination, type of material affected, and the method of remediation. For a more precise estimate, it's advisable to consult professionals who specialize in indoor environmental quality (IEQ) assessments.

The costs for professional mold remediation services in Dubai can range widely. A basic assessment alone might start from around 1000 dirhams ($275 USD), depending on the size of the area and whether a mold test is required. For actual removal, costs could climb to anywhere between 3000 to 8000 dirhams ($825 - $2175 USD) for small to medium-sized areas.

The methodology used in Dubai can include both wet methods (which involve the use of water and chemicals to clean or remove mold) and dry methods (using HEPA vacuum cleaners, fans, and other equipment to control spore distribution). The choice between these depends on the severity of the situation. In some cases, especially when there's extensive mold growth or structural damage, a combination approach might be necessary.
